Both are considered to be the best jobs.
So its upto you which one you wnat to do.

If you want to work in the technical side than IES would be good
But if you want to get into administration than IAS would be good

Approx seats in the IES exams in the year 2012 was 560.
Category wise classification of seats was not given by UPSC

Eligibilty to apply to IES exams is BE/BTECH PASS
Age should be between 21 and 30 years
Next IES exams would be held from 28th June 2013 for 3 days


Eligibilty to apply for the UPSC Civil services exams is Graduation pass
Age should be ebtween 21 and 30 years
Next UPSC Prelims Exams will be held on 19th MAY 2013
Notifications for this exam will come out on 2nd February 2013
